As Playback Theatre expands across cultures and contexts, the ethical challenges it encounters have become more nuanced and pressing. Since its inception, Playback Theatre has been grounded in ethical responsibility – because we engage with real people and their lived experiences. Today, that responsibility calls for deeper reflection, sensitivity, and discernment. Join Jonathan Fox, co-founder of Playback Theatre, assisted by Hoa My Nguyen, for this engaging online course exploring the evolving ethical landscape of our practice. Together, we’ll examine how to respond with greater responsibility, self-awareness, and humanity. Through eight thoughtfully designed lessons and three live Zoom gatherings, you’ll gain practical tools, real-life case reflections, and community dialogue to deepen your ethical sensitivity and strengthen your Playback practice.
